Property Description

Underhill Estate Agents are delighted to bring to market this spacious 3 bed, end terraced period cottage located within the heart of this popular village location on the outskirts of Exeter. Offered CHAIN FREE, this characterful property benefits from an entrance hall, WC/Cloakroom, a well proportioned lounge/dining room, kitchen/breakfast room, utility room on the ground floor and three good sized bedrooms and a family bathroom on the first floor. This lovely property further benefits from a lawned rear garden and a good sized garage. Fine outlook and views over neighbouring area including Old Poltimore House walled kitchen garden, adjoining countryside and beyond. Viewings are highly recommended.

The charming village of Poltimore offers convenient access to the city and its wide range of amenities, shops, restaurants, and transport links. The M5 (J29) and A30 are both within easy reach, as is Exeter Airport, while the nearby villages of Broadclyst and Pinhoe offer a variety of local facilities including schools, shops and railway connections.
